M17 half way there

Hi All,

I’ve had 3 sessions at this so far trying to get it finished before the moon was too full. Alas the first session I discarded due to bad framing and the 3rd session I was overcome half way through by dew. Now the sky is full of clouds and when it’s not it’s full of moon so I’ll have to wait a while to finish it. Here is my progress so far. The processing isn’t perfect, I’ll spend more energy on it when I get all the data I want.

108x180sec @ iso 400
Canon 350d astromodified STC Duo Filter
Celestron C9.25 reduced 0.63
HEQ5 pro guided by Nexguide SAG
